CouchDB Hosting Feature Overview
Provider | Starting Price | Storage (GB) | Bandwidth | Free Domain | |
---|---|---|---|---|---|
$4.00 | 20-4000 | 5 TB | No | Visit Kamatera | |
$2.90 | 30-110 | Unlimited | Yes | Visit Ultahost | |
$2.99 | 100-200 | Unlimited | Yes | Visit Hostinger | |
$1.00 | 10-unlimited | Unlimited | Yes | Visit IONOS | |
$2.99 | 20-300 | Unlimited | Yes | Visit A2 Hosting |
Rating Overview:
- Overall Score: 4.9
- Features: 5.0
- Reliability: 5.0
- User-Friendly: 4.8
- Support: 4.9
- Pricing: 4.8
Kamatera offers CouchDB Hosting, catering to businesses and developers looking for a high-performance, scalable, and customizable database hosting solution. Known for its cloud computing expertise, Kamatera is an excellent choice for those requiring advanced CouchDB hosting capabilities.
Detailed Analysis:
Features: Kamatera’s CouchDB Hosting is expected to offer top-notch features like high-speed performance, scalable resources, and enhanced security measures, suitable for demanding database applications.
Reliability: Renowned for its robust infrastructure, Kamatera ensures excellent uptime and stable performance, crucial for database hosting where consistent availability is key.
User-Friendly: Despite its focus on advanced services, Kamatera is likely to provide a user-friendly experience for CouchDB Hosting, featuring intuitive management tools and interfaces.
Support: Known for excellent customer service, Kamatera’s CouchDB Hosting users can expect comprehensive support, available for technical guidance and to address any hosting issues.
Pricing: Pricing for Kamatera’s CouchDB Hosting services is expected to be competitive, reflecting the premium nature of the service with customizable plans to suit various needs and budgets.
Pros and Cons:
- Advanced features and high performance for demanding CouchDB applications
- Excellent infrastructure reliability for consistent database operations
- User-friendly tools for efficient database management
- Exceptional customer support for all technical needs and inquiries
- Pricing might be higher than basic database hosting solutions, aligned with its advanced features
- The range of options and configurations may be more complex than required for simpler database hosting needs
Rating Overview:
- Overall Score: 4.4
- Features: 4.3
- Reliability: 4.5
- User-Friendly: 4.4
- Support: 4.4
- Pricing: 4.6
Ultahost provides CouchDB Hosting, catering to users who seek a reliable and cost-efficient solution for their database needs. Known for balancing affordability with quality, Ultahost is an appealing choice for small businesses and individual developers.
Detailed Analysis:
Features: Ultahost’s CouchDB Hosting likely offers essential database functionalities such as secure data storage, performance optimization, and backup solutions, ensuring an effective database hosting environment.
Reliability: With a focus on stable performance, Ultahost is expected to provide good uptime and consistent service, crucial for maintaining continuous database access and operation.
User-Friendly: True to its customer-centric approach, Ultahost’s CouchDB Hosting should feature a straightforward interface and easy-to-use management tools, making database administration accessible for all users.
Support: Users of Ultahost’s CouchDB Hosting can expect competent customer support, ready to assist with any setup or maintenance issues.
Pricing: Pricing for Ultahost’s CouchDB Hosting services is anticipated to be very competitive, appealing to budget-conscious users without compromising on essential functionalities.
Pros and Cons:
- Cost-effective solution for CouchDB hosting, with key features included
- Solid performance and reliability for consistent database operations
- User-friendly management interface for hassle-free database administration
- Responsive and helpful customer support for a smooth hosting experience
- Advanced customization options might be limited compared to high-end database hosting services
- Scalability for larger, more demanding database applications could be more constrained than with larger providers
Rating Overview:
- Overall Score: 4.6
- Features: 4.5
- Reliability: 4.6
- User-Friendly: 4.7
- Support: 4.5
- Pricing: 4.8
Hostinger offers CouchDB Hosting services, tailored for individuals and small to medium-sized businesses seeking a cost-effective and straightforward database hosting solution. Hostinger is known for making hosting accessible to a wide range of users, making it a popular choice for those new to database hosting or operating on a tight budget.
Detailed Analysis:
Features: Hostinger’s CouchDB Hosting is expected to include essential database features such as secure data storage, basic performance optimization, and effective backup solutions
Reliability: Consistent uptime and stable performance are likely key aspects of Hostinger’s CouchDB Hosting, ensuring that databases are reliably accessible and functional.
User-Friendly: In line with Hostinger’s approach, their CouchDB Hosting should provide a user-friendly interface and tools, simplifying database management for users of all technical levels.
Support: Responsive and helpful support is a hallmark of Hostinger, so users can anticipate efficient assistance for any CouchDB Hosting related queries or issues.
Pricing: The pricing for Hostinger’s CouchDB Hosting services is likely to be among the most competitive in the market, appealing to those seeking a balance of affordability and essential features.
Pros and Cons:
- Very cost-effective for basic CouchDB hosting requirements
- Reliable uptime and stable performance for consistent database accessibility
- User-friendly management tools for easy database setup and maintenance
- Accessible customer support for a hassle-free hosting experience
- Advanced features and high-end performance might be limited compared to more specialized CouchDB hosting providers
- Scalability and customization options could be more constrained than those provided by higher-end services
Rating Overview:
- Overall Score: 4.6
- Features: 4.7
- Reliability: 4.6
- User-Friendly: 4.5
- Support: 4.6
- Pricing: 4.6
iONOS offers reliable CouchDB Hosting solutions tailored to businesses and individuals seeking efficient database management and deployment. With a focus on performance and reliability, iONOS’s CouchDB Hosting services provide users with the infrastructure and resources they need to store and manage their data seamlessly.
Detailed Analysis:
Features: iONOS’s CouchDB Hosting plans come with a comprehensive set of features designed to meet the needs of database-driven applications. From scalable storage options and high-speed SSDs to advanced security measures and data backup solutions, iONOS ensures that users have everything they need to manage their databases effectively.
Reliability: iONOS boasts a reliable infrastructure optimized for CouchDB environments, ensuring high availability and performance for database-driven applications. With redundant systems and advanced monitoring, iONOS delivers consistent server performance for users who rely on CouchDB Hosting for their data management needs.
User-Friendly: iONOS prioritizes user experience, offering intuitive control panels and database management tools for managing CouchDB Hosting environments. Whether you’re a seasoned developer or new to database hosting, iONOS’s platform simplifies the setup and management of CouchDB databases for all users.
Support: iONOS provides responsive customer support, with a team of experts available to assist users with any database-related queries or issues they may encounter. From database setup and configuration to troubleshooting and optimization, iONOS’s support team is dedicated to helping users make the most of their CouchDB Hosting experience.
Pricing: iONOS’s CouchDB Hosting plans are competitively priced, offering excellent value for money compared to other providers in the industry. With transparent pricing and no hidden fees, iONOS ensures that users can deploy and manage their CouchDB databases without breaking the bank.
Pros and Cons:
- Comprehensive features for CouchDB database hosting
- Reliable infrastructure optimized for database environments
- User-friendly control panels for easy database management
- Limited scalability compared to dedicated database hosting platforms
- Some advanced database features may require additional configuration or expertise
iONOS’s CouchDB Hosting solutions provide businesses and individuals with the reliability and performance they need to manage their databases effectively. With advanced features, reliable infrastructure, and responsive support, iONOS ensures that users can focus on storing and managing their data without worrying about server management. Experience seamless CouchDB hosting with iONOS’s CouchDB Hosting today!
Rating Overview:
- Overall Score: 4.9
- Features: 5.0
- Reliability: 5.0
- User-Friendly: 4.9
- Support: 5.0
- Pricing: 4.8
A2 Hosting provides specialized CouchDB hosting services designed for developers looking for a high-performance environment to deploy and manage their NoSQL databases. Known for its commitment to speed and reliability, A2 Hosting ensures that CouchDB applications run efficiently and smoothly with their optimized hosting solutions.
Detailed Analysis:
Features: A2 Hosting’s CouchDB hosting includes SSD storage for faster data access and processing speeds, which is crucial for database operations. The hosting plans offer easy CouchDB installation, managed backups, and enhanced security features like SSL encryption to protect data transmission. Developers can also access server resources via SSH, allowing for advanced database management and configuration.
Reliability: Leveraging state-of-the-art data centers equipped with cutting-edge technology, A2 Hosting provides a 99.9% uptime guarantee, ensuring that CouchDB databases are always available and performant. Their servers are configured to optimize the unique requirements of CouchDB, offering fast response times and handling large volumes of data without degradation in service.
User-Friendly: A2 Hosting offers a control panel that is intuitive and easy to navigate, enabling users to manage their CouchDB environments effortlessly. This includes tools for configuring server settings, managing databases, and monitoring system health, all accessible through a user-friendly interface.
Support: A2 Hosting is renowned for its “Guru Crew†support team, which is available 24/7 to assist with any CouchDB hosting queries. Whether it’s installation, configuration, or performance optimization, their knowledgeable staff provides expert advice and practical solutions to ensure users get the most out of their hosting service.
Pricing: A2 Hosting offers a variety of CouchDB hosting plans, tailored to suit different needs and budgets. Each plan is transparently priced, detailing the resources and features provided, helping customers make informed choices based on their specific requirements.
Pros and Cons:
- High-speed SSD storage enhances database access and performance
- Comprehensive security measures ensure data integrity and privacy
- Expert support available around the clock for any technical issues
- Premium features and higher resource allocations may result in higher costs compared to basic hosting options
- The technical nature of managing a CouchDB server may require a steeper learning curve for beginners
How Did We Choose The Top CouchDB Hosting Providers?
To identify the top CouchDB hosting providers, we conducted a comprehensive evaluation process focusing on several key criteria:
Market Research and Provider Identification: We started by researching the hosting market to identify providers offering CouchDB hosting services. Our focus was on providers known for their expertise in database hosting and those offering specific CouchDB hosting solutions.
Platform Compatibility and Features: We assessed the compatibility of hosting platforms with CouchDB and examined the features offered. This included support for CouchDB databases, version compatibility, and any additional tools or services tailored for CouchDB users.
Performance Metrics: Performance is critical for database hosting. We evaluated server performance metrics such as CPU speed, RAM allocation, disk storage type, and database optimization capabilities. High-performance servers ensure efficient data retrieval and processing.
Data Security and Backup Solutions: Security is paramount for database hosting. We examined the security measures implemented by providers, including firewalls, encryption protocols, access controls, and backup solutions. Data integrity and protection against unauthorized access or data loss were key considerations.
Scalability and Resource Allocation: Scalability is essential as database needs can grow over time. We reviewed the scalability options offered by providers, including the ability to easily scale resources such as CPU, RAM, and storage based on demand. Flexible resource allocation ensures optimal performance without overprovisioning.
Customer Support and Reliability: Prompt and reliable customer support is crucial for database hosting. We evaluated the responsiveness and expertise of support teams, availability of support channels (such as live chat, ticketing system, phone support), and overall customer satisfaction ratings. A reliable hosting provider ensures minimal downtime and quick resolution of issues.
User Feedback and Reviews: User feedback and reviews provide valuable insights into the actual user experience. We analyzed user reviews and ratings on reputable platforms to gauge overall customer satisfaction, service quality, and any recurring issues or concerns reported by users.
By considering these key criteria, we identified the top CouchDB hosting providers that excel in performance, security, scalability, reliability, and customer support, ensuring an optimal hosting experience for CouchDB users.
Understanding CouchDB Hosting and Its Applications
CouchDB hosting refers to the provision of hosting services specifically optimized for CouchDB, a popular open-source NoSQL database system. Here’s an overview of CouchDB hosting and its applications:
Database Management: CouchDB hosting platforms offer specialized environments designed to efficiently manage CouchDB databases. These environments are configured to optimize database performance, ensure data integrity, and facilitate easy database administration.
Data Storage and Retrieval: CouchDB hosting services provide reliable storage solutions for CouchDB databases. They utilize robust storage systems capable of handling large volumes of data while ensuring fast and efficient data retrieval for applications and services.
Web Applications: CouchDB hosting is ideal for web applications that require flexible and scalable database solutions. It supports the storage and retrieval of structured and semi-structured data, making it suitable for content management systems, e-commerce platforms, and collaborative web applications.
Mobile Apps: CouchDB’s support for offline data synchronization makes it a preferred choice for mobile app development. CouchDB hosting platforms offer features and tools for seamless synchronization between mobile devices and backend databases, enhancing the user experience of mobile apps.
Document-Oriented Database: CouchDB is a document-oriented NoSQL database, storing data in JSON-like documents. CouchDB hosting providers ensure optimal performance and scalability for document storage and retrieval, making it suitable for applications with complex data structures.
Data Replication and Backup: CouchDB hosting services often include data replication and backup features to ensure data redundancy and disaster recovery by synchronizing copies of databases across multiple servers, enhancing data availability and fault tolerance.
API Integration: CouchDB hosting platforms offer APIs (Application Programming Interfaces) for seamless integration with various programming languages, frameworks, and third-party services.
In summary, CouchDB hosting provides a reliable and scalable infrastructure for managing CouchDB databases, making it suitable for a wide range of applications, including web and mobile apps, content management systems, and collaborative platforms. Its document-oriented nature, data synchronization features, and flexible APIs make it a versatile choice for modern database-driven applications.
Benefits of CouchDB Hosting
CouchDB hosting offers numerous benefits that make it an attractive choice for developers and businesses seeking efficient and scalable database solutions. Here are some key advantages of opting for CouchDB hosting:
Scalability: CouchDB hosting platforms are designed to scale effortlessly as your database requirements grow. They provide flexible storage options and distributed architectures that can handle increasing volumes of data and user requests without compromising performance.
High Availability: CouchDB hosting providers ensure high availability of databases by employing redundancy and failover mechanisms. This minimizes downtime and ensures continuous access to critical data, even in the event of hardware failures or server issues.
Data Security: CouchDB hosting services prioritize data security by implementing robust encryption protocols, access controls, and regular security audits. This helps protect sensitive data from unauthorized access, ensuring compliance with data protection regulations.
Fault Tolerance: CouchDB’s built-in fault tolerance features, such as data replication and automatic conflict resolution, are leveraged by hosting providers to ensure data consistency and reliability. This minimizes the risk of data loss or corruption due to network issues or server failures.
Performance Optimization: CouchDB hosting platforms optimize database performance through caching mechanisms, indexing strategies, and query optimizations. This results in faster data retrieval and improved application responsiveness, enhancing the overall user experience.
Cost Efficiency: By outsourcing database management to CouchDB hosting providers, businesses can save on infrastructure costs, maintenance efforts, and staffing requirements. CouchDB hosting plans often offer flexible pricing models based on resource usage, allowing businesses to scale resources as needed without overpaying.
Developer-Friendly Environment: CouchDB hosting environments provide developers with tools, APIs, and SDKs that streamline database development, testing, and deployment processes. This accelerates application development cycles and enables rapid iteration and innovation.
Community Support: CouchDB has a vibrant and active community of developers, contributors, and users who share knowledge, offer support, and contribute to the continuous improvement of the CouchDB ecosystem. CouchDB hosting providers often leverage this community support to enhance their services and address user needs effectively.
Overall, CouchDB hosting combines scalability, reliability, security, and performance optimizations to deliver a comprehensive database hosting solution suitable for a wide range of applications and use cases. Its focus on data integrity, availability, and developer productivity makes it a compelling choice for modern database-driven applications.
How CouchDB Hosting Works
CouchDB hosting operates on a robust set of principles and technologies, ensuring efficient data storage, retrieval, and management. Here’s an overview of how CouchDB hosting works:
Document-Oriented Storage: CouchDB uses a document-oriented NoSQL approach, where data is stored in JSON-like documents. These documents are flexible, schema-free, and can contain nested data structures, making CouchDB ideal for handling complex and evolving data models.
Database Replication: CouchDB hosting providers utilize database replication to ensure data redundancy and availability. Replication involves copying databases across multiple servers or nodes, allowing for seamless failover, load balancing, and disaster recovery capabilities.
RESTful API: CouchDB exposes a RESTful HTTP API, making it accessible and interoperable with a wide range of programming languages, frameworks, and tools. Developers can perform CRUD (Create, Read, Update, Delete) operations, query data using MapReduce functions, and manage database configurations via HTTP requests.
Master-Master Replication: CouchDB supports master-master replication, enabling bidirectional synchronization of data between distributed databases. This distributed architecture facilitates data consistency, offline access, and collaborative workflows across multiple nodes or devices.
Multi-Version Concurrency Control (MVCC): CouchDB employs MVCC to manage concurrent access to data without locking mechanisms. Each database update creates a new revision, preserving the integrity of previous versions and allowing for efficient conflict resolution and data synchronization.
Conflict Resolution: In cases where conflicting updates occur due to concurrent edits, CouchDB employs automatic conflict resolution strategies based on revision histories. Users can define custom conflict resolution functions or rely on CouchDB’s built-in algorithms to resolve conflicts and maintain data consistency.
MapReduce Indexing: CouchDB utilizes MapReduce indexing to create views and indexes for efficient data querying and aggregation. Map functions extract data from documents, while reduce functions aggregate and summarize results, enabling complex data analysis and reporting capabilities.
Partitioning and Sharding: CouchDB hosting platforms may implement partitioning and sharding techniques to distribute data across multiple servers or clusters. This horizontal scaling approach improves performance, scalability, and fault tolerance by reducing data hotspots and balancing workload across nodes.
Security Mechanisms: CouchDB hosting services implement robust security measures, including authentication mechanisms, role-based access controls (RBAC), SSL/TLS encryption, and firewall protections. These security layers safeguard data confidentiality, integrity, and availability, meeting compliance requirements and mitigating security risks.
Monitoring and Management Tools: CouchDB hosting providers offer monitoring dashboards, management consoles, and analytics tools to track database performance, resource utilization, and operational metrics. These tools empower administrators to optimize configurations, troubleshoot issues, and ensure optimal database health.
By leveraging these foundational components and features, CouchDB hosting delivers a reliable, scalable, and developer-friendly environment for managing diverse data workloads, supporting real-time applications, and driving business insights. Its architecture promotes flexibility, performance, and resilience, making it a preferred choice for modern database hosting needs.